Output 83133e2bb0d4e32d7f0b5d113dff5a23ee8f5754cc1906000363dce99317c5aa:2

value
34979273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af9b897c66abe5554b73d4f9a77a664a754e8800 OP_EQUAL
address
MPugouR31Rer61E38XHRF6AfrfKwpNseFE
transaction
83133e2bb0d4e32d7f0b5d113dff5a23ee8f5754cc1906000363dce99317c5aa
spent
true